7-Day Andaman Honeymoon Itinerary

Wednesday, September 20: Arrival in Andaman

Start your romantic honeymoon getaway in Andaman with a relaxed afternoon at Radhanagar Beach, one of the most beautiful beaches in Asia. Take a leisurely walk hand-in-hand along the white sandy shore and enjoy the breathtaking sunset. In the evening, savor a candlelight dinner at a beachfront restaurant.

  • Radhanagar Beach: Estimated cost - Free, Time spent - 2-3 hours
  • Beachfront Restaurant: Estimated cost - INR 1500-3000 per couple, Time spent - 2-3 hours
Thursday, September 21: Exploring Havelock Island

Embark on a romantic morning boat ride to Elephant Beach, known for its crystal clear waters and vibrant coral reefs. Enjoy snorkeling together, exploring the colorful marine life. In the afternoon, visit the picturesque Vijaynagar Beach for a peaceful picnic amidst nature's beauty. End the day with a romantic dinner at a seaside shack.

  • Elephant Beach: Estimated cost - INR 1000 per couple (including boat ride and snorkeling), Time spent - 4-5 hours
  • Vijaynagar Beach: Estimated cost - Free, Time spent - 2-3 hours
  • Seaside Shack: Estimated cost - INR 1500-2500 per couple, Time spent - 2-3 hours
Friday, September 22: Discovering Neil Island

Begin your day with a visit to Bharatpur Beach, popular for its pristine white sand and shallow waters ideal for swimming. Spend the afternoon at Laxmanpur Beach, known for its stunning sunset views. Indulge in a couple's spa session in the evening, rejuvenating your senses.

  • Bharatpur Beach: Estimated cost - Free, Time spent - 2-3 hours
  • Laxmanpur Beach: Estimated cost - Free, Time spent - 2-3 hours
  • Couple's Spa Session: Estimated cost - INR 4000-6000 per couple, Time spent - 2-3 hours
Saturday, September 23: Island Hopping to Ross and North Bay Islands

Embark on an exciting day trip to Ross Island, once the administrative headquarters of the British in Andaman. Explore the ruins, visit the stunning beaches, and witness the deer and peacock population. Afterward, head to North Bay Island for an unforgettable underwater experience with sea walking or scuba diving. Enjoy a romantic dinner cruise in the evening.

  • Ross Island: Estimated cost - INR 1500-2000 per couple (including ferry ride), Time spent - 4-5 hours
  • North Bay Island: Estimated cost - INR 3000-5000 per couple (including water activities), Time spent - 4-5 hours
  • Romantic Dinner Cruise: Estimated cost - INR 5000-8000 per couple, Time spent - 2-3 hours
Sunday, September 24: Exploring Port Blair

Visit the historic Cellular Jail in the morning, learning about India's freedom struggle. Take a romantic stroll through the picturesque Marina Park and enjoy the scenic beauty. Afterward, head to Corbyn's Cove Beach for some relaxation and water sports. In the evening, explore the local markets and indulge in delicious street food.

  • Cellular Jail: Estimated cost - INR 30 per person, Time spent - 2-3 hours
  • Marina Park: Estimated cost - Free, Time spent - 1-2 hours
  • Corbyn's Cove Beach: Estimated cost - Free, Time spent - 2-3 hours
  • Local Markets: Estimated cost - Varies, Time spent - 2-3 hours
Monday, September 25: Excursion to Baratang Island

Embark on an adventurous journey to Baratang Island, famous for its limestone caves and mangrove forests. Explore the fascinating caves and take a boat ride through the mangroves, spotting exotic wildlife. Return to Port Blair in the evening and enjoy a romantic dinner by the sea.

  • Baratang Island: Estimated cost - INR 3000-4000 per couple (including boat ride), Time spent - 8-9 hours
  • Romantic Dinner by the Sea: Estimated cost - INR 2000-4000 per couple, Time spent - 2-3 hours
Tuesday, September 26: Farewell to Andaman

On your last day in Andaman, take a morning visit to the Anthropological Museum, gaining insights into the indigenous tribes of the Andaman and Nicobar Islands. Spend the afternoon at Wandoor Beach, known for its clear waters and coral reefs. In the evening, bid farewell to Andaman with a sunset cruise.

  • Anthropological Museum: Estimated cost - INR 20 per person, Time spent - 1-2 hours
  • Wandoor Beach: Estimated cost - Free, Time spent - 2-3 hours
  • Sunset Cruise: Estimated cost - INR 3000-5000 per couple, Time spent - 2-3 hours

Hidden Gems and Local Favorites

For a unique experience, consider visiting the remote Jolly Buoy Island, known for its pristine coral reefs and vibrant marine life. Another off-the-beaten-path attraction is the Chidiya Tapu, or Bird Island, where you can spot various species of birds amidst lush greenery. Locals highly recommend trying the traditional seafood delicacies at Annapurna Restaurant in Port Blair.
